    Derived from bitter orange (Citrus amara), originating in southern Vietnam, Orange Polyphenols are a botanical cosmetic active valued for their toning and skin-smoothing properties. Bitter orange trees are spiny evergreen citrus trees naturally rich in vitamin C, polyphenols, and plant flavonoids, making this extract a popular ingredient in modern skincare and body-care formulations.

    In cosmetic applications, orange polyphenols are especially appreciated as lipolytic and decongesting botanical ingredients. They are frequently used in toning, slimming, and contouring skincare products, where they help improve the appearance of skin firmness while supporting smoother, more refined skin texture. 

    This citrus-derived active is commonly included in body creams, serums, gels, and targeted treatments designed to help tone the skin and reduce the visible appearance of cellulite.

Product Details

  • INCI: Water, Propylene Glycol, Citrus Aurantium Amara (Bitter Orange) Flower Extract, Leuconostoc/Radish Root Ferment Filtrate
  • Appearance: Amber colored liquid
  • Direct pH: 6.0-7.0
  • Solubility: Water soluble
  • Usage Rate: 1%-10%

Shelf Life & Storage: If stored properly, this product can last 12 months from the date of manufacture. Keep the seal tightly in a cool, dry area away from direct light and humidity. For best storage, keep the sealed container in the refrigerator.
